Explain the meaning of and list the support for long-term potentiation as a physical basis for memory. Provide an example of how this process may be disrupted.


Module 32 AP psych

Respuesta :

Wilbur
Wilbur Wilbur
  • 25-01-2022

Answer:

~provides a neutral basis for learning and remembering associations

~evidence that confirms Long-Term Potentiation as a physical basis for memory

- drugs block LTP interfering with learning

- mutant mice engineered to lack an enzyme needed for LTP couldn't learn their way out of the maze
